VCP Cloud - Planning Central



Oracle Supply Chain Planning Cloud - "Planning Central" surely seems impressive with the new simpler GUI, in-memory planning engine and pre-integrated cloud. Release 11 is first release for Fusion Planning Central. 

Planning Central provides demand planning, inventory planning and supply planning capabilities all in one application with linkage to execution systems. 
  • Demand Management: Forecast based of shipment/booking history with sales orders consuming forecast. Stat engine supporting causal factors with NPI capabilities inbuild
  • Inventory Planning: Stat safety stock derivation based of demand volatility & stocking goals. 
  • Supply Planning:  Material and Resource requirement calculation based of SS and customer demand with lead times, calendars, availability etc. in consideration.
Planning Central key features:

  • Unified Data model with common set of dimensions for supply & demand plans
  • 200+ Seeded measures
  • End to End business process flow support (CollectData>PlanDemand>PlanInventory>PlanSupplies>Execute)
  • Integrated with OrderMgmt, MaterialsMgmt, InventoryMgmt, Mfg & Purchasing Cloud Services
  • Integrated with Fusion ERP for collections & planning output releases
  • OOTB Plan Summary dashboard
  • Planner Workbench (Configurable)
  • Seeded Data views (Configurable)
  • Seeded Analytics (Configurable)
  • Embedded Analytics (Configurable)
  • Excel Export/Import option
Here is a demo from Oracle on Planning Central's first release. 


Remember all the configurations/setups for Planning Central very much like other Cloud applications is required to be done using Functional Setup Manager(FSM). Offering is Value Chain Planning and functional area is Planning Central. FSM should be used for setting up source systems definition, profiles, loading data and configuring planning analytics.

ASCP 12.2.5.X Release Key Features


ASCP 12.2.5 Release Features


Oracle has provided handful of enhancements in ASCP module with the latest release. Here is a summary of some key features which are now available.

  • Collection filtered by Category Sets
    • Ability to setup category sets and then use as filter to collect/refresh only subset of product data into ASCP
    • Improves performance of collection process
  • Demand Schedule Specific Forecast processing:
    • Forecast processing options/consumption criteria definition can be done at demand schedule level with this enhancement. This allows one to submit for different region/Product LOBs separate schedules. 
    • Following options can be enabled at demand schedule level now
      • Backward days
      • Forwards days
      • Spread forecast
      • Consume by Forecast bucket
      • Explode Forecast
    • Plan level options are used if no demand schedule level values are set
    • Improved plan accuracy and allows more flexibility 
    • Plan Options> organization tab has these additional options.
  • Maximize Resource Utilization
    • Works with Constrained plan without detailed scheduling plan type only 
    • Allows better use by front loading production and minimize resource downtime
    • ASCP will also use alternate sources of supplies (e.g. alternate resources, substitute components etc.) too if needed for maximizing resource utilization 
    • There though are some fine prints on what all ASCP can do with this feature enabled, e.g. plan can violate the sourcing split % if needed for maximizing resources. 
    • Use only if key need is to front load and maximize resource utilization 
  • Extended Support for Reservation (for plan type : Constrained without detailed scheduling)
    • Support so far:
      • Reservation b/w on hand supplies & sales order demands
      • Reservation b/w on hand, internal requisitions and maintenance work order supply types to maintenance work order demands 
    • Extended support for:
      • Reservation b/w discrete jobs, process batches, purchase orders & requisitions with sales orders/process batch demands
    • Allows companies with Make To Order environment to reserve certain work order supplies to sales order demand
    • Supply - Demand reservation could be 1-1, 1-Many, Many-1 or Many-Many 
  • Enhanced Project Netting for Project Mfg environment 
  • Enhanced User experience with Alta GUI

    • Improved user interface provides ADF based Alta GUI, which is where future GUI is going towards for Oracle.
    • New supply planning work area:
      • Allows personalizing content and page layouts 
      • User can define how he wishes to review and analyze the plan output
      • Plan definition can be done with new GUI
    • Enhanced Supply/Demand workbench using new GUI
    • Favorites option
      • Taxonomy of  most used/critical elements (E.g. items, resources, suppliers, orders etc.) 
      • Planners can define their own set and use for filtering in Supply Demand work area
    • Exception Management using new GUI

APCC 12.2.5.1 Release Features

APCC's latest release 12.2.5.1 is available and comes with following enhancements to the features: 

  • Org Specific Manufacturing Calendar
    • Earlier only one calendar setup by MSC:APCC Calendar Code, now you can setup multiple
    • All mfg calendars for all planned orgs in ASCP plan will be available in APCC now
    • Single global plans can be better analyzed and reviewed using org specific calendar which respects corresponding work days and start of weeks etc
  • Material plan enhancement
    • Ability to drill down from horizontal plan into details using Category & Org context embedded
  • New reports in SCA dashboard & Project driven Supply Chain Dashboard
    • Additional OOTB reports now available in various tabs for Supply Chain Analyst dashboard
    • Additional OOTB dashboard content for Project environment

Rapid Planning, an addition to Value Chain Planning products suite

In May 2009, during Collaborate 2009 event Oracle provided a preview of it's new product "Rapid Planning" and they made a timely release of the product by announcing it's availability on 16th Nov 2009. Rapid planning will benefit customers with it's quicker, real-time, event driven planning and simulation abilities.

Extending the Information-Driven Value Chain
Leveraging its unique web services and open, standards-based architecture, Oracle Rapid Planning customers can enable reduced supply chain decision-making time with the following capabilities:
Fast, event-driven simultaneous material and capacity planning for rapid scenario analysis and real-time evaluation of supply chain events.
Fast sales and operations planning scenario simulation, integrated with Oracle’s Demantra.
Compatible and complementary capabilities to Oracle Advanced Supply Chain Planning.
Mass edit of supply chain data, enabling customers to conduct ad-hoc, rapid scenario modeling without the need to make changes to the ERP data or transactions.
Predictive and actionable insight via embedded analytics, a spreadsheet-style flexible user-interface, and embedded exceptions and scenario comparisons.
Comprehensive constraint modeling to mimic real-life planner decision making such as alternate bills of material, routings, sources and shipping methods, substitution and lead times.
Multi-enterprise visibility and planning, spanning internal facilities and contract manufacturers.
Multi-planner collaboration and simulation to help speed up the analysis and decision-making process.
Integration with ERP to help quickly translate decisions into actions and release planning recommendations directly to execution without latency.

ASCP Data Collection: A high level overview

Process of collecting data in proper format from ERP(transactional) instance/schemas to APS(Planning) instance/schema, for easy usage by APS modules like ASCP, GOP, IO, Demantra and others. ERP stores all master data & transactional data, in respective product schemas like INV, BOM, WIP, MRP, PO etc., which is collected to MSC schema for planning applications.
Components of Collection process:
1. Refresh Snapshots: runs always only on the ERP source instance in Distributed environment
2. Planning Data Pull: Pulls data from ERP source schemas to MSC_ST% tables
3. ODS Load: Does data cleansing & manipulation, followed by loading base MSC% tables from MSC_ST%(Staging) tables

For integrated Demantra, further collection of history & related data is required to populate Demantra base tables. The processes for these collections are run from the responsibility "Demand Management System Administrator". The Standard collection option in Demantra responsibility is same as ASCP standard collection. The other collections processes are Demantra specific.

Modes of Collection:
1. Standard: Using this option, one can manually launch collection in three methods, Complete Refresh, Targeted Refresh & NetChange.
2. Continuous: this is an automated collection process, which requires minimal manual intervention and it keeps planning instance data synchronized with ERP source instances. It automatically determines which method of collection should be used.

Few notes to remember:
1. Source ERP instances can be a mixture of releases and can be a legacy instance as well
2. ASCP instance can share instance with one of the ERP instances
3. Collection is required even if APS & ERP instances reside on same instance
4. Supplies against Drop Ship are not collected, as ASCP doesn't plan for drop ship sales

ASCP - Unconstrained Plan

Few basic characterstics can be listed as below;
An unconstrained plan:
- doesn't consider manufacturing capacities (material & resources)
- assumes infinite capacity
- results are same as traditional MRP
- simply is an statement of what all resources would be needed to meet the production schedule
- can come handy in long term decision making for resource requirement planning

Oralce's ASCP module can be used for unconstrained planning as well, unconstrained ASCP plans are usually like baby steps towards more complex, holistic, constrained & optimized planning ASCP world.

Unconstrained ASCP plans thus form an integral part of ASCP implementation, as it can be used for getting familiar with application, as well as in verifying the ASCP outcomes. You can compare the unconstrained ASCP plan recommendations with your MRP plan results and thus can validate the basic ASCP setup.

Two important aspects to be focused on while running ASCP unconstrained plan should be:
1. Try to duplicate results of legacy MRP system.
2. Increase familiarity & confidence on ASCP application.

Steps to implement an unconstrained ASCP plan:
1. Create DB link between transaction source(ERP) server and APS(Advanced Planning & Scheduling) server
2. Setup collection program
3. Run collection to copy supply chain model from source instance to APS server
4. Define an ASCP plan and setup plan options.(with no constraints)
5. Launch the plan

VERIFICATION: Unconstrained plan is designed to produce identical results as that of legacy ERP system. This becomes useful in verifying implementation and in building users confidence with the ASCP application.

Oracle Advanced Supply Chain Planning(ASCP)

ASCP module forms the core of Oracle's APS suite, with its holistic global supply & distribution planning functionalities. With ASCP you can plan simultaneously for all your manufacturing plants & distribution houses at different granularity of time in a single plan, which considers the latest demand, forecast, sourcing rules, current inventory and production levels. ASCP offers a variety of plan options and plan types, which can be used to model individual business supply chain planning needs. In general, ASCP implementations start with an initial phase of "unconstrained ASCP plans" usage. In due course of time and with planner's readiness towards understanding the inputs, setups and results, one can move forward with "constrained" ASCP plans (e.g. EDD, ECC & Optimized plans).

Why MRP isn't sufficient?
Becasue:
- It is sequential in nature
- It plans based on unconstrained production, storage & transportation capacity
- It does not optimizes the supply recommendations
- It has no decision support capabilities

Few of major features of ASCP module can be listed as:
- Global Visibility
- Rapid ROI
- Supports Centralized & Decentralized planning
- Supports mixed mode manufacturing
- Holistic Plans for high level planning & Detailed scheduling
- Finite Constraint based Planning(CBP) & Scheduling
- Optimization across multiple Objectives
- Online Replan & Simulation capabilities
- Supports Global Order Promising(GOP)
